ЗАДАЧИ
problems.ru
О проекте | Об авторах | Справочник
Каталог по темам | по источникам |
К задаче N

Проект МЦНМО
при участии
школы 57
Фильтр
Сложность с по   Класс с по  
Выбрана 1 задача
Версия для печати
Убрать все задачи

Напечатать все перестановки чисел 1..n так, чтобы каждая следующая получалась из предыдущей перестановкой (транспозицией) двух соседних чисел. Например, при n=3 допустим такой порядок:

3.2 1 $ \to$ 2 3.1 $ \to$ 2.1 3 $ \to$ 1 2.3 $ \to$ 1.3 2 $ \to$ 3 1 2
(между переставляемыми числами вставлены точки).

   Решение

Задачи

Страница: 1 [Всего задач: 2]      



Задача 98834  (#2.5.1)

Тема:   [ Нерекурсивная генерация объектов ]
Сложность: 4

Перечислить все последовательности длины n из чисел 1..k в таком порядке, чтобы каждая следующая отличалась от предыдущей в единственной цифре, причём не более, чем на 1.
Прислать комментарий     Решение


Задача 98835  (#2.5.2)

Тема:   [ Нерекурсивная генерация объектов ]
Сложность: 4

Напечатать все перестановки чисел 1..n так, чтобы каждая следующая получалась из предыдущей перестановкой (транспозицией) двух соседних чисел. Например, при n=3 допустим такой порядок:

3.2 1 $ \to$ 2 3.1 $ \to$ 2.1 3 $ \to$ 1 2.3 $ \to$ 1.3 2 $ \to$ 3 1 2
(между переставляемыми числами вставлены точки).
Прислать комментарий     Решение

Страница: 1 [Всего задач: 2]      



© 2004-... МЦНМО (о копирайте)
Пишите нам

Проект осуществляется при поддержке Департамента образования г.Москвы и ФЦП "Кадры" .